I know this is probably a stupid question, but searching has not rendered an answer.

I am a “new to me” DA42 NG owner and I am trying to make sure I am properly calculating front baggage weight properly. My question is: does the weight of a full TKS tank on the NG model subtract from the allowance of 66 LBS in the front baggage area? If so it would seem the full TKS tank is actually a fuzz more in weight than the allowance of 66 LBS.

Thanks for the help in answering this question. I have searched the POH with no answer found.

Jonathan - As stated by Emir, the TKS tank and the nose baggage compartment are separate items on the W&B loading. So the weight of the TKS fluid does not count against the 66lbs load limit for the nose compartment. From a practical perspective, I am usually flying with full or almost full TKS. I still am able to carry loads in the front baggage compartment but I am watching the W&B.
